Planning Commission postpones conditional-use hearing for outdoor storage at West Trenton Avenue
Summary
The commission voted to postpone CU-09-2026, an application to establish outdoor storage for Yellowstone Landscaping at 429 West Trenton Avenue, to the next meeting to allow the applicant to attend and present. The postponement was moved and seconded and carried.

The Planning Commission postponed consideration of CU-09-2026, a conditional-use request from GMCO Ventures to establish outdoor storage for Yellowstone Landscaping at 429 West Trenton Avenue. Commissioners debated options — postponement to the next meeting or denial if the applicant did not appear — and ultimately voted to give the applicant one more meeting to present.
A motion to postpone was made and seconded; the item will return to the commission’s agenda at the next meeting. If the applicant does not appear at that subsequent meeting, the commission indicated it may choose to deny the request at that time.
